#1 There is a reason they call it The Sunshine State. The majority of the year is sunny and warm. With more than 200 sunshine-filled days a year, Florida offers its residents warm and sunny weather nearly all year round. While spring up north may be muddy and chilly, in Florida it is some of the best weather on earth. Spring, which runs from late March to May, sees warm temperatures throughout Florida, and very little rain. This means it is the perfect season to set outside, kayaking, playing on the playground, golfing, walking the path in your neighborhood, or simply sitting outside on the back porch.

#4 You'll see a lot of visitors. Florida is so great this time of year that everyone wants to enjoy it, from winter "snow birds" to spring break tourists. These visitors come mostly from mid-December to mid-April and leave when things really start to heat up. This time of year, the restaurants, roads, and theme parks will be pretty packed. When they leave, you and the other residents will have the place to yourself again! If you can brave the outdoors in July, you'll find it's mainly you and those who live around you left in the area.
